WebVelocity Based Training works when an athlete is coached to lift concentrically as fast as possible for the weight on the bar (without sacrificing form). This is an expression of intent, and whether they are lifting at 90% or 50% of 1RM, the lifter needs to ‘move the bar fast’. noticed in email https://puntoholding.com

WebThe peak ground acceleration, duration, and frequency content of earthquake can be obtained from an accelerograms. An accelerogram can be integrated to obtain the time variations of the ground velocity and ground displacement. WebAug 5, 2024 · Peak concentric velocity – this is simply the peak speed during the concentric phase of the exercise and is usually calculated every 5-milliseconds. This metric is used for ballistic/power-based exercises such as the power clean, … WebMean propulsive velocity – definition and calculation. Mean propulsive velocity is calculated as the value from the start of the concentric phase until the acceleration of the bar is lower than gravity (-9.81 m·s-2).
